American singer who helped to define the emerging sound of Motown in the early 1960s.
One of Motown’s first superstars, she became recognized as ”The Queen of Motown” until her departure from the company in 1964.
b. 13/05/1943 in Detroit, Michigan, U.S.A.
d. 28/07/1992 Kenneth Norris Jr. Cancer Hospital, Los Angeles, California, U.S.A.
